arcade999 wrote:Do anyone here think that roblox was better before?
As I've said countless and multitude of times before, Roblox was better before the 2012 era made it a kiddy hangout game.

Roblox in the early 2000's was great, when I first played it as a kid, it was place of fun where you could ride dragons and fight using rockets and swords, even go to a pizza place.

Roblox, today, has corporate decisions that are understandably good for the game's lifespan, but cringy neverless.

The removal of Tix, the number one currency in Roblox was understandable, but made the game seem more like a cash grab for kids to bother their busy parents to buy them "Builder's Club", I remember there was a Lifetime Builder's Club option, but I think it's gone now.

The several clone games clutters the homepage over the good ones.

I'm glad there's still some good games on the site, such as the Pokemon and Mario ones, but it makes me sad, when I see Roblox, now a empty shell filled with money and greed, it was my childhood game, now it's a corporate businessman that thrives on cringe.

Roblox has changed, for the better of it's lifespan but for the worst of how it is now.

I recently started a retro-gaming focussed Livestream channel on twitch called http://twitch.tv/3UP_Moon and I've been having a great time revisiting some RPGs from my childhood~ I recently completed a Randomizer run of Earthbound (SNES) but in a challenge mode called Ancient Cave Mode (it tosses out the story and reshuffles all the areas of the game into an 8 level labyrinth, with a boss at the end of each level)~ It was really fun~

I attempted a Nuzlocke Challenge (essentially Hard-Mode) run of Pokemon: Fire Red Version on GBA, but failed our first attempt, and now I am streaming Final Fantasy IX (FF9) which is a total nostalgia trip~ I loved this game and have a very vivid memory of getting it right when it came out~ It's been really fun so far streaming it and especially of note, is the music and the visual atmosphere of the game. Final Fantasy 9 is a real return-to-form and I'm happy to be experiencing it live with the viewers ~
